About

Stella Bogino is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change and Nature and Landscape Conservation. According to data from OpenAlex, Stella Bogino has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 501 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Atmospheric Science, 23 papers in Global and Planetary Change and 17 papers in Nature and Landscape Conservation. Recurrent topics in Stella Bogino's work include Tree-ring climate responses (23 papers),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(22 papers) and Forest ecology and management (13 papers). Stella Bogino is often cited by papers focused on Tree-ring climate responses (23 papers),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(22 papers) and Forest ecology and management (13 papers). Stella Bogino collaborates with scholars based in Argentina, Spain and Colombia. Stella Bogino's co-authors include Felipe Bravo, Estéban G. Jobbágy, Heinrich Spiecker, Cyrille Rathgeber, Vivien Bonnesoeur, Ricardo Villalba, Hugo Enrique Fassola, Celia Herrero de Aza, Rafael Calama and Vicente Rozas and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Forest Ecology and Management and Biomass and Bioenergy.
